Women's Basketball Can't Get Past Medgar Evers

Brooklyn, NY-- The Brooklyn College Women (5-13, 1-8 CUNYAC) were not able to hold off the Medgar Evers College Cougars (5-12, 3-6 CUNYAC) as they fell 71-59.

The Cougars opened the game on a 17-5 run over the first seven minutes and would not trail during the contest. Brooklyn would fight back to within five points at 21-16 when senior guard Jaclyn Cavalcante (James Madison / Brooklyn, NY) sank two fouls shots capping an 11-4 rally. The Bridges were then held scoreless over the next three minutes, as Medgar Evers had four different players score during a 10-0 spurt that increased the edge to 31-16.

The Bridges made it interesting in the second stanza, scoring the nine straight points to open the period. A Christina McDonnell (Staten Island Tech / Staten Island, NY) three-pointer cut the gap to six points, 39-33 just over two minutes into the half. Several minutes later, freshman guard Amber Gordon (Bishop Loughlin / Brooklyn, NY) converted a trifecta to bring BC to within five points at 42-37.

Over the next four minutes, the Cougars eruppted on a 10-0 run, increasing their lead to 15 points at 52-37. Brooklyn would follow that up with an 11-0 rally of their own, cutting the score to 52-48 with eight minutes to play. Back-to-back jumpers by Shauntelle Nelson and Danielle Moseley, combined with a Roshanna Hoppie free throw extended the Medgar Evers lead to nine points, at 59-50. The BC shooters went cold, as the Bridges misfired on nine of their last 11 attempts from the field, while the Cougars shot better than 55 percent (5 for 11) down the stretch.

Leading the way for the Bridges was Gordon, who had a team high 19 points and six steals. Cavalcante chipped in with 11 points and six steals of her own. Sophomore forward Joelle Laurenceau (Midwood / Brooklyn, NY) also had a solid night contributing 10 points with seven rebounds. McDonnell was the squad's leading rebounder, collecting eight caroms.

The Bridges come back to Roosevelt Gym to take on the York College Cardinals for a Saturday afternoon conference bout. Tip off is scheduled for 12:30 pm.
